The worth of a solid diagnostic brain
Electrical job is a profession, yet medical diagnosis is an art. A lot of phone calls start with a sign. Breakers trip. Lights lower. Outlets feel warm. The wrong assumption sends you going after ghosts. The best examination isolates the cause in minutes.
One summer season, I checked out a medical workplace whose UPS units shrieked every mid-day. The very first professional exchanged batteries. A second included a circuit. I invested 20 mins logging voltage while the building's chillers cycled and found a neutral under-torqued in the panel feeding that floor. Heat and lots incorporated to go down voltage just sufficient to activate alarm systems. A quarter turn with the right torque screwdriver, a recheck, and the trouble disappeared. That originated from method, not good luck. A certified electrician in San Antonio who diagnoses daily brings calibrated meters, infrared cameras, and an individual mindset. That mix usually conserves more money than any type of discount.

Local context shapes excellent design choices
San Antonio's climate and building supply produce patterns that a local team understands.
Heat indicates attic room runs are harsh on conductors and on humans. Derating cable ampacity for ambient temperature is not optional. In summertime, I measure attic temperature levels before sizing futures for heating and cooling equipment or EV battery chargers. The National Electrical Code allows adjustments, yet experience informs you when charitable sizing saves callbacks.
Storms and lightning make rise defense more than an upsell. I have seen routers and garage openers fry during a close-by strike also when the panel seems penalty. Whole home surge security at the solution plus factor of use defense on expensive electronic devices produces a layered defense ideal to our region. The price sits in the emergency electrician San Antonio low hundreds for most homes, often under 5 percent of what a solitary fell short home appliance replacement would certainly cost.
Soil problems and water tables complicate grounding. Partly of the city where pieces meet rock, supplemental electrodes and appropriate bonding to metallic water services matter more than in loamy soils. A San Antonio electrician that has actually driven ground poles into this earth knows when to include a second rod and when to test dirt resistivity instead of guessing.
Older areas lug their own story. Alamo Heights and Monte Panorama include homes with fabric protected wiring and panels that predate GFCI requirements. These systems can be made safe without wrecking historical interiors, however the strategy has to be surgical. I have run brand-new homeruns from attic room to cellar making use of existing chases after and cautious fishing. It is slower than gutting a wall surface, yet it appreciates the residential property and the proprietor's budget.

When to call an emergency electrician in San Antonio, and what to do first
Most middle of the night calls share necessity but also adhere to a strategy. Before you get the phone, you can make the scene safer and the service quicker with a few quick actions.
- If you scent shedding or see smoke from a panel or electrical outlet, cut power at the major breaker if you can reach it safely, after that step back and call an emergency situation electrician in San Antonio. Do not open a hot panel with a screwdriver.
- If water has gone into a panel or subpanel as a result of roof covering leaks or a flood, do not touch anything. If it is risk-free and completely dry to do so, shut down power at the main. Otherwise wait for help.
- For a total blackout while neighbors still have power, call CPS Power to eliminate an utility problem, after that call a certified electrician. If your meter base or solution pole is harmed, it is your responsibility to repair.
- If a breaker will not reset and journeys immediately, leave it off. Repetitive resets harm the breaker and mask a real mistake that requires diagnosis.
- If half your home is dark and the various other half brilliant, you might have lost a leg of service. This can damage home appliances. Shut off big loads and look for help quickly.
Those steps reduce the fixing window. When I show up and locate a silent panel rather than one still cigarette smoking or a consumer that already called the energy, the repair service begins without detours. That efficiency equates to decrease price and much less downtime.

Energy cost savings that show up on the bill
Not every upgrade repays, but some do, and they are not constantly the showy ones.
Lighting retrofits still provide. Relocating a 20,000 square foot workplace from older fluorescents to quality LEDs can reduce lights power by 40 to 60 percent. Include controls that dim when daytime floods a space, and you acquire more savings. In a single family members home, replacing incandescent and halogen with high CRI LEDs decreases warmth tons and electrical usage. I avoid the cheapest lights. The shade high quality frustrates people and they tear them out later.
Power top quality issues for services with sensitive tons. When voltage sags and harmonics float about, electronics act terribly. Appropriately sized transformers, high quality surge defense, and stabilizing stages in panels avoid subtle waste. A commercial electrician in San Antonio can gauge, design, and correct prior to you acquire pricey devices to fix an issue wiring created.
EV charging is below in force. For a house, I size the circuit and route for warmth and future capability. Channel buried under driveways is sized for a second run later. For workplaces, I speak with owners concerning load monitoring so they do not outgrow the service the initial year. Smart chargers let a building share ability across several lorries. Planning these details early avoids trenching a lot twice.

The silent anxiety alleviation of an upkeep plan
Most business customers I offer timetable annual or semiannual assessments. We torque lugs, tidy panels, inspect emergency lights, test GFCI and AFCI defense, and scan with infrared for locations. In older homes, I advise a three to five year appointment that tries to find dampness intrusion at service infiltrations, loose links at the primary, and GFCI protection where code has evolved.
The highlight concerning these visits is not the checklist we mark off. It is the problem we capture 2 months before it fails on a holiday weekend. A hairline split in a service pole weatherhead, a rust trail at a meter base, a breaker that feels warmer than siblings at a typical tons. Those information cost little to deal with early. They cost a whole lot to repair when the rain arrives.

Real examples from the field
A home owner in Helotes included an EV battery charger with a 3rd party installer, after that called when breakers started tripping on summertime afternoons. The house had a 125 amp solution feeding two cooling and heating units and the new battery charger. Lots computations showed peak need touchdown near the solution limit throughout heat waves. We upgraded to a 200 amp solution, installed a whole home rise guard, and rebalanced circuits. The tripping vanished. The permit and evaluation route satisfied their insurer, and the resale listing later highlighted the upgraded solution as a feature.
A small resort near the River Walk endured licensed emergency electrician San Antonio arbitrary lift mistakes. Several suppliers pointed to the elevator control board. Our meter informed a various tale. Voltage went down during laundry and cooking area peaks as a result of an undersized feeder and an unbalanced panel. We added a dedicated feeder and corrected the equilibrium. Lift faults quit, and the resort avoided a five number control board replacement.
A bakery in Southtown called after a small electrical fire in a back room. An unlicensed service provider had actually touched a new circuit from a lighting go to include a refrigeration unit. The conductors overheated inside a concealed joint box. We changed damaged electrical wiring, mounted a correct specialized circuit, and documented the repair service for their insurer. The proprietor informed me later on that the simplest cash they ever before invested got on the authorization fee.

How do electricians check wiring?
Electricians check wiring using tools such as multimeters, voltage testers, and circuit tracers. They inspect for proper connections, continuity, and damaged insulation. They may also test circuits under load to ensure safety and compliance with electrical codes. Documentation of findings is common for larger projects.
